Doofus

usgb/ˈduːfəs/Volume

LampPro Tip 1/3

Colloquial Usage

Used mainly in casual conversation among friends or on social media. Not for formal situations.

Illustration for Colloquial Usage
After he tripped over his own feet, everyone called him a doofus.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Mild Insult

It's a playful insult for small mistakes or silly behavior, not for serious criticism.

Illustration for Mild Insult
She wore her shirt inside out like a total doofus today.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Not Global

It’s understood in English-speaking countries but may not be known in other cultures.

Illustration for Not Global
My British cousin called his friend a doofus, and we all laughed.
